I just got a new 27" and I've been moving everything over. but my iphone is synced w/ my old library that I moved over but I wanted to start fresh w/ a new account once everything was moved (it's easier than wading through all of the junk on the old one)

But Itunes is saying I can't sync w/ the new library unless I dump everything on my phone and start over. Is there a way to unsync w/ the 1st library and sync w/ the new one w/out losing all of my music that's already on the phone?

^^ No no no...

Copy the folder from /user/library/iTunes to your new computer. This will copy your previous backups and it will be recognized as the same phone.

I've done this before and it saved me from starting from scratch.

Just overwrite (replace) if you get prompted.

The two folders you need:

/user/library/iTunes
/user/music

It's possible you need another folder called /user/Library/MobileSync... I can let you know shortly when I get home. Can't check that on XP... lol

Make sure that iTunes is closed during this process.
